4 day Fly in, Fly out Serengeti Safari
Tour Summary
This is a four day Camping Safari accompanied by a guide in the Serengeti which can be essential as it's a large national park and famous for the great migration and big cats. This tour gives you adequate time in the parks to view wild animals and relax while avoiding long drives.

Day 1 : Zanzibar to serengeti
You will be picked up from the hotel and driven to the Zanzibar airport, where you will board a small plane that flys into the Serengeti airstrip, arriving in Serengeti in the late am as the flight may transit in Arusha & from there you will start game drives to the afternoon where you will head to the camp for lunch before heading out for an evening game drive & enjoying a surreal sunset in the Serengeti. then after all that you will head to the accommodation for dinner & overnight stay

Day 2 : Serengeti National Park
After breakfast, you will continue with the game drive, on this day you have an option to do a full-day game drive or you can divide sessions into an early morning session then an evening session then after which is for those who will want to relax in the afternoon but for those wishing to see a lot we advice heading out for the whole day.

Day 3 : Serengeti National Park
You'll have full days in the Serengeti National Park. We are completely flexible with your preferences and this day will be organized according to your wishes. Every day of the safari, your guide will discuss with you the best timings for you, including the game drives and the wake-up time. For example, on this day, you could do a morning game drive, return to the camp for lunch and relaxation, then finish with an afternoon game drive. Or you could do a full-day game drive with a picnic lunch.

Day 4 : Flying Out of the Serengeti
On this day, we suggest a very early wake-up in order to do an early morning game drive (when the animals are more active) and see one of the best sunrises you'll ever witness. It's really one of the most beautiful experiences to have. After the game drive, we will return to the camp for a rewarding brunch and then we'll proceed to the airstrip for your flight back to Zanzibar. Alternatively, instead of the early morning game drive, you may choose to stay at the camp for a bit of relaxation.

>Visas are required when traveling to Tanzania, Foreigners may apply for a visa online in advance of travel
>A passport valid for a minimum of six months beyond visa insurance and/or date of entry
>Yellow fever vaccination is required for all travelers arriving from or having transited through countries where yellow fever is endemic
>Bring Binoculars for better sighting
>Bring appropriate clothes for Safari, Pants, Long sleeve shirts, Hats, Sunglasses, and Sun cream.
>Bring a camera for pictures and binoculars, but if you do not have binoculars you will get them from us
>It is recommended to bring insect repellant for use in the park
>A warm sweater and Jacket as the night can be chilly at high altitudes (Up to 5 C)
>Blue and Black colors to avoid while in the park as they attract Tsetse liis
>You are advised to wear light and breathable material as it can get hot out on a game drive
>You should cover up on a game drive as you spend many hours outdoor
